Those round glasses and that calm, everyday look are exactly what makes Taro Sakamoto so fun to spot: in Sakamoto Days, the former legendary hitman is now trying to live a quiet life, focused on his family and his convenience store. This official Youtooz figure captures him in vinyl, at around 12 cm tall.
Sakamoto’s appeal is all about contrast: he looks like a normal, laid-back dad, yet the moment someone threatens what matters to him, the old reputation still holds true. The people circling him, from allies to assassins who won’t let the past go, keep pulling him back into trouble. This figure leans right into that “ordinary life” angle, showing him in a workaday pose that clashes perfectly with what he’s known for.
Visually, it’s a chibi-style character with short gray hair, a small gray mustache, and light gray round glasses. He’s wearing a yellow shirt under a large green apron with a white label featuring Japanese characters on the chest, blue pants, and dark sandals. In one hand he holds a small can with a white-and-red label and a paintbrush, and in the other a black tool connected to a gray hose, like a sprayer or blower nozzle. The stance is solid on both feet, making it easy to display on a shelf or desk.
